WebJan 27, 2024 · Anxiety disorders, depression, post-traumatic stress disorder, chronic pain, suicidal ideation, or suicide attempts are some of the damaging mental health effects of being in an abusive marriage or intimate relationship. Women are at a higher risk for experiencing abuse within an intimate relationship or marriage.
